James was a farmer around Kyneton / Sutton Grange.
On 27 May 1902 James & Jane celebrated their golden wedding anniversary at Sutton Grange, Victoria.[13][14]
James died at Sutton Grange on 27 September 1912, aged 85,[15] and he was buried at Sutton Grange Cemetery.[16][5][17]
Research Notes
12 Aug 1854 Argus advert for horse care, in possession of stables
22 Jul 1880 Argus article noting James Gray of Sutton Grange as a judge for Kyneton Ploughing Match
4 Nov 1884 Kerang Times and Swan Hill Gazette - Clydesdale Stallion "SIR JOHN" was bred by Mr James Gray, of Sutton Grange
